After B.E in Mechatronics, you may opt for advance courses in the fields such as :
-Electronic engineering
-Computer engineering
-Control engineering
-Systems design engineering
-Software engineering
-Mechanical engineering
-Robotic engineering
Choose the one which matches your interest and skills as it will help to achieve long term career goal.
